It's Here Poem by Isha Trivedi

It's Here



In the cars that crash and the cliffs that collapse,
And the fires that kill and the fevers that relapse,
Death is hiding
Watching
Waiting…
You need not be afraid
We’ll all be brought down
By blade
Or grenade
Or from being betrayed
Open closed doors and let it float by,
See it now or see it when you die.
The one common fear
Fear of the unknown
Face reality at others’ deaths
Not at your own.
“Live for the afterlife, for eternity, ” they claim,
Live life as you wish: death is no fair game.
Stand on the ground of principle,
Stray from the ground of the typical.
Keep to those you trust,
Stay forever objective and just.
Death does not judge
Nor do I
Know who I am?
I’m Death’s spy.
